Coach Profile
2002-2002 • Michigan State
One defining program at Michigan State.
Morris Watts coached 1 seasons, won 20.0%, and posted an average SRS of -4.6. Best season: 2002 Michigan State. The profile was offense-first with limited volatility context. One primary stint defined the run.
